I'm trying to get my GP and MCC done early this month so I can work on my Micromen figures. My fan fic alien is done. I read somewhere that you couldn't use a star wars head for this figure. It had to be something completely different. Well this is what I came up with.

His name is Ragu and is from the planet Anime. People from his planet are typically short with large heads, blue or green or purple hair and sometimes have eyes that take up two-thirds of their head. They are known for making extreme facial expressions to express emotion.

Ragu lost his arm thru a short lived experiment with the dark side of the force. He was trying to resurrect his dead wife thru a technique he found on a remote abandoned Sith fortress. He has since brought himself back from the dark side but still searches for a way to become whole again.

His only force ability is to throw force lightening. This is a fairly common ability among most Anime. Some are even good enough to compact it into a lightening ball.

That's the technique I use now for curing sculpty. I microwave a cup of water for three minutes and then put the figure in the boiling water for at least five minutes. It works great and I never have a melted mess.

Because of a suggestion by Darth_Ennis, I've started this thread to collect past Group Project entries. Group Projects are something I started over at RebelScum a few years ago. It has moved from FFURG and now to here. So far we have had twelve projects over two years.

The idea behind the group project is that we all create the same character based on any reference pictures we can find. We discuss parts to use and customizing techniques. We are suppost to post work in progress pictures of the character.

In this thread, I'm going to start off with Group Project 9 which was based completely here at JD. You can check out Group Projects 1-8 over at FFURG on this page: http://www.ffurg.com/casting_call/cc-48.htm

Here is a listing of past Group Projects:

Group Project 1: Biggs Darklighter in Imperial Academy Uniform
Group Project 2: Adult Clonetrooper in Kamino Training Gear / Queen Amidala's Handmaidens
Group Project 3: ANH Infinities Leia Organa / Kenny Baker as R2-D2
Group Project 4: KOTOR Mission Vao and Carth
Group Project 5: Crossovers (Muppets, Lunney Tunes, Peanuts, Simpsons, etc.)
Group Project 6: Santa Wookiees
Group Project 7: Mon Calamari Dancer and Fem-bot
Group Project 8: Snoova and Jedi Defender self customs
Group Project 9: Tonnika Sisters
Group Project 10: Clone Wars TV Series (minus the clones)
Group Project 11: Rykrof Enloe
Group Project 12: Ysanne Isard and Admiral Daala
Group Project 13: Jango Fett
